Sleeping Bear Dunes

Michigan’s Sleeping Bear Dunes National Lakeshore is one of the most beautiful places in the United States. At Sleeping Bear, you can see beautiful beaches, trees, wildlife, and streams as you go 64 miles around Lake Michigan. It is an amazing show of wind, sky, and sand dune on the shores of the lake.
